open roles
Senior Software Engineer
Sabio Group is a trusted expert in Contact Centre, AI and Data. We design, build and run automation led customer experiences for leading brands, combining deep domain expertise with modern engineering and a consulting mindset. We’re collaborative, curious and outcomes driven, and we invest in people who want to learn and grow in a supportive, inclusive environment.
At Sabio Group, we're dedicated to fostering an environment where employees thrive. Since 1998, we've built a dynamic culture that is both challenging and fun, driven by a team of ambitious, knowledgeable individuals who are passionate about leading the AI CX revolution. We're seeking creative, resourceful people to join our fast-growing organisation, where you'll have the opportunity to develop your skills and contribute to a culture of continuous learning.
At Sabio Group, we're dedicated to fostering an environment where employees thrive. Since 1998, we've built a dynamic culture that is both challenging and fun, driven by a team of ambitious, knowledgeable individuals who are passionate about leading the AI CX revolution. We're seeking creative, resourceful people to join our fast-growing organisation, where you'll have the opportunity to develop your skills and contribute to a culture of continuous learning.
We work with some of the world’s largest organisations across various industries, delivering exceptional digital customer experiences through our unique blend of expertise, technology, and insight. As one of Europe’s fastest-growing providers of CX transformation solutions, we’re committed to sustainability, diversity, and inclusion, ensuring our workforce reflects the diverse society we serve. Join us and help shape the future of customer experience.
We are currently looking for a passionate and enthusiastic Senior Software Engineer to join our team.
As a Senior Software Engineer within the AI Practice, you will play a key role in designing, engineering and delivering high quality, secure, scalable solutions for our customers. You will bring a strong DevSecOps mindset, an automation first approach, and the ability to rapidly learn new technologies.
This role is hands on, customer facing, and central to the technical delivery of AI enabled and cloud native solutions across a broad range of platforms and environments.
As a Senior Software Engineer within the AI Practice, you will play a key role in designing, engineering and delivering high quality, secure, scalable solutions for our customers. You will bring a strong DevSecOps mindset, an automation first approach, and the ability to rapidly learn new technologies.
This role is hands on, customer facing, and central to the technical delivery of AI enabled and cloud native solutions across a broad range of platforms and environments.
Key Responsibilities
- Design, build and maintain high quality software solutions across a range of programming languages and cloud technologies.
- Apply an automation first approach across provisioning, deployment, testing and operations.
- Engineer secure, scalable and observable systems using modern DevSecOps practices.
- Work directly with customers to understand requirements, present technical approaches, and provide clear, engaging updates and documentation.
- Troubleshoot complex issues across infrastructure, code, integration layers and cloud services.
- Contribute to internal engineering standards, reusable modules, and continuous improvement within the AI Practice.
- Collaborate with crossfunctional teams including architects, platform engineers and delivery leads to ensure highquality, ontime delivery.
- Keep up to date with emerging technologies and proactively assess opportunities to introduce new tooling, frameworks or patterns.
Skills Knowledge and Expertise
Essential Skills, Experience and Competencies
- 5+ years’ experience in Software Engineering, ideally across multiple stacks.
- Strong DevSecOps mindset, including automation first engineering practice.
- Ability to learn new technologies rapidly and apply them effectively.
- Excellent problem solving and troubleshooting skills.
- Strong written and verbal communication skills, including customer facing engagement.
- Terraform
- Ansible
- C# (ideally .NET 8+)
- Java (ideally including Spring)
- JavaScript with at least one modern framework (React, Angular, etc.)
- Bash
- PowerShell
- AWS, ideally including Amazon Connect
- Containerisation (Docker, Kubernetes, etc.)
- Linux (any distribution)
Preferred but Not Required
- MSSQL or similar relational database
- Redis or similar caching technology
- Azure
- Google Cloud Platform (GCP)
- Go
- VMware
- Telephony experience, particularly IVRs
Benefits
This is your chance to join and friendly and passionate team that will motivate you to learn and develop your career in the company.
Benefits may include:
Benefits may include:
- Remote/Flexible work
- Discovery Medical Aid
- Connectivity Allowance
- 15 days paid holiday a year- (this includes three Sabio days)
- Momentum EAP
The Small Print
Strictly No Agencies; any submission of resumes without prior request from Sabio Group will not be deemed as an introduction and therefore will not warrant an introduction fee. All applicants must have the right to work in the territory to which the role relates (UK & EU). Sabio Group are unable to offer sponsorship on any roles advertised.